Features: No primer required. Excellent adhesion to galvanized steel, mild steel, bonderite steel, PVC,
Masonite, concrete and wood. Good adhesion to aluminum and polyethylene. PRO-AQUABAN sticks to
polypropylene but does not pass adhesion test.
Chemical and solvent resistance: PRO-AQUABAN is resistant to mild acids, alkalis, detergents,
mineral spirits, acetone, esters, and ammonium nitrate. PRO-AQUABAN is resistant to the alkali in
concrete and other masonry products. PRO-AQUABAN can be used on concrete without primer and can
be used as a block filler. When using on new plaster, allow the plaster to cure for 180 days before
applying.
PRO-AQUABAN will soften and swell in aromatic solvents i.e. toluene, xylene and unleaded gasoline.
Surface preparation: All surfaces should be clean, free of dust, grease and wax. Heavily rusted
surfaces should be wire brushed and/or sanded. Molded and mildewed surfaces should be washed with
a mildew remover and allowed to dry before applying.
Coverage: Apply PRO-AQUABAN at a thickness of 1.1 mm for most applications. The coverage is 4.5
square metres per 3.785 litres tins.
Drying time: The rate of drying is dependent upon thickness, temperature and humidity. In general, one
coat having a thickness of 0.5 mm will dry in two to four hours at an average temperature of 25 Celsius.
Do not apply when the surface and/or air temperature is below 10 Celsius. Excess drying timing can be
caused by low temperature, high humidity or poor ventilation.
Application: Apply by brush, roller or spray. If applying by spray, use a large diameter spray tip.
Clean-up: Thin films of PRO-AQUABAN cure at an extremely fast rate. Brushes, rollers and spray tips
should be cleaned immediately with water. If cleaning is delayed, it will be necessary to use an aromatic
solvent such as toluene, xylene or Exxon solvent 150 for clean-up.
